As the country start to get back to normal here are our Top Tips for transitioning back into the office.
There are still a number of lockdown restrictions to help ensure the publics safety, to adhere to these, any staff who can telecommute or prefer to should continue to do so.
It’s important to remember that fellow workers will be travelling various places, so doing your best to stick to social distancing and using PPE where you can.
If a large number of employees have been telecommuting, it is likely that data efficiency has taken a huge hit, so as your colleagues return to the office, clear out any unnecessary files and documentation.
Even though your peers will be returning to the workplace, a number of workers may need to remain at home if they are at risk, so adjust the work structure and distribution of the workload accordingly.
